14:22 — Offline sync regression confirmed (Terrapath field-survey app)

At 14:22 the on-call engineer reproduced the data-loss path: surveys saved while offline were marked synced once connectivity returned, even when the upload was rejected. The queue flush skipped the server acknowledgement check introduced in the previous sprint. Release manager note: the fix must ship before the coastal survey season. The offending build is identified by the token recorded below.

session token of kawif-fawig = htk31_f3f599be2b1a34affb1efa8d0feccf8

Finance Review — Revised Commission Scheme

Quick summary for sales leads on the new Orvantis commission plan. Base rate moves from 4% to 3.5%, but accelerators now kick in at 90% of quota instead of 100%, so most of you come out ahead if pipelines hold. Multi-year deals on the Castellan suite earn a 1-point kicker. Clawbacks apply only to cancellations within 90 days. Finance modelled last year's numbers: median payout rises about 6%. Effective next quarter, no retroactive changes. The reasoning behind the timing is below.

internal memo for kagap-hahig: Project Aldeth slips by six weeks because of the staffing delay.

## SQL lint gate

All release branches run Querytide before merge. Rules live in `querytide.rules.yml`; do not edit mid-cycle. Failures on naming (`QT-101`) and missing `WHERE` on deletes (`QT-204`) block the release — no overrides. Style-only findings can be waived by the release manager via `querytide waive`. To run the gate locally, export the standard `.env` used by CI. Set `QUERYTIDE_PROFILE=release` and `QUERYTIDE_STRICT=1`. The waiver service requires authentication; its secret belongs on the next line of the env file.

sealed setting: RELAY_SECRET5=82864

Subject: Responsibility change — formula sandboxing

Hello on-call,

Ownership of the Cinderquill formula sandbox is transferring this week. As a reminder, user-supplied formulas execute in the isolated evaluator with strict CPU and memory ceilings; any breach alert should be escalated immediately rather than silenced. Runbooks remain in the usual wiki space. Effective Thursday, all sandbox escalations route to the new owner named below.

account owner for fajep-yagef: Kasix Eliiel